CHET-FM
CHET-FM is a community and campus radio station in Chetwynd, British Columbia, Canada. It broadcasts on 94.5 FM and uses the Peace FM branding. The station is owned by The Chetwynd Communications Society and shares studios with its television sister CHET-TV on North Access Road in downtown Chetwynd.
CHET-FM began broadcasting on December 5, 1996, at 5:00 a.m.
In 2002, the CRTC approved a 50-watt rebroadcast transmitter at 104.1 FM in Dawson Creek, with the call sign CHAD-FM.
Technical details: CHET-FM is a low-power class LP station with an effective radiated power of 27 watts, horizontal polarization only, and a height above average terrain of 265 metres.
Repeater: 104.1 CHAD-FM in Dawson Creek.
